Why mobile phones and electronic devices are put on Airplane mode

By A Mystery Man Writer

The device stops transmitting cellular signals. It also turns off the wi-fi connectivity. Airplane mode disables Bluetooth as well. Get more Aviation News and Business News on Zee Business.
